H.E. Dr. Ahmed bin Mohammed Al-Sayed, Minister of State for Foreign Trade Affairs at the Ministry of Commerce and Industry, met on Sunday, 25 May 2025, with H.E. Qais bin Mohammed Al Yousef, Minister of Commerce, Industry and Investment Promotion of the Sultanate of Oman. The meeting took place on the sidelines of H.E. Dr. Al-Sayed’s official visit to the Sultanate of Oman, leading a high-level Qatari trade and investment delegation that included representatives from public and private sector institutions.
The two sides reviewed the growing economic relations between Qatar and Oman and discussed ways to enhance bilateral cooperation in trade and investment, serving mutual interests and supporting economic development in both countries.
As part of the visit, H.E. Dr. Al-Sayed also met with H.E. Sheikh Dr. Ali bin Masoud Al Sunaidy, Chairman of the Public Authority for Special Economic Zones and Free Zones in Oman. Discussions focused on areas of cooperation in developing free zones and exchanging expertise on creating investment-attractive business environments.
His Excellency and the accompanying delegation toured the “Invest Oman” Hall, where they were briefed on the integrated services provided to local and international investors. The delegation also visited the Oman Investment Authority and was introduced to the projects and initiatives it oversees.
